Explore The Agenda:
- Introduction (10 minutes): Welcome, aims and housekeeping.
- The Importance of Sleep (45 minutes): Why sleep underpins health, resilience and productivity; how sleep affects workplace dynamics and safety.
- Understanding Sleep Issues (45 minutes): Primary causes of poor sleep in working populations and practical first‑line strategies.
- Coffee Break (15 minutes)
- Sleep & Mental Health (45 minutes): The relationship between sleep and mental health; boundaries and red flags.
- Improving Sleep Health in your Organisation (45 minutes): Learn how to start conversations about sleep. Think about sleep culture in your organisation and how sleep can be better supported. Strategise on ways to effectively bring better sleep health into your workplace.
- Conclusion & Accreditation (15 minutes): Reflection, personal action plan, and awarding of Sleep Ambassador accreditation; next steps and follow‑up.
